I did last October. I reached out dealerships in NH, VT, MA, and RI, hoping that someone might be able to offer a discount. All of them offered me MSRP and refused to negotiate. Some wanted $3,000 non-refundable deposit and required me to finance through the dealership with a higher rate than my credit union was offering. A few dealers were just aggressive, rude, and condescending. They wanted me to order ASAP or tried to sell me what they had on the lot.

So after that experience, I reached out to a broker outside of New England. They assured me about the discount %, refundable deposit, and they are fine with me bringing my own financing. So I paid my fee to them and received 7.5% off MSRP. The process was pretty easy. Deposit was only $1,000, which was refunded after I picked up my car.

I had to fligh out and pick up my car, but I think it was worth the time. It was fun driving my new X5 back home and I got to know the car pretty well.
